THE HOARDINGS.

WHEN into the town I go, Under sad and leaden skies I see hoardings, row on row, Flare in pink and yellow dyes.
Glittering promises they bear: Food to gorge and drink to swill; Spectacles of pleasure rare, Cures for every mortal ill.
'Tis man's paradise of hope Mocking starving winter's night; Filling wretched souls who grope, With a gorgeous lie of might!
Poet, do not vainly dream Of a past forgot for long, Let the wonderful hoardings stream In their splendour through your song.
Fling away the beautiful, Withered flower of ancient birth: See! It springs in blossom full, Fresh from out the teeming earth!
